Microsoft is making it easier for Students, who attend qualifying universities, to receive Office 365 for free. Students can check their availability by signing up with their school email address. If your college or university has a campus wide Volume License then you will be prompted to sign in with your school password and will be redirected to a page with an "install now" link.
This free download can be downloaded onto five PCs or Macs and will grant you access to Office apps on Windows tablets and iPad. Signing up also grants you 1TB of OneDrive storage and access to Office Online. Students can download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Outlook. A similar program for faculty will be made available in October which gives faculty access to Office 365 ProPlus.
